About Parklee Primary School:

Parklee Primary School sits at the heart of the community and encompasses the values and strengths of the town’s proud history with our origins dating us back to the original Lee Street School. We are proud to be part of the Education Partnership Trust (EPT), who are committed to creating outstanding schools which transform learning, lives, and communities.

 

Our school has a culture built around our values of Positivity, Aspiration, Resilience, Kindness, Loyalty, Empathy and Excellence. These core values underpin everything we do.

About the Education Partnership Trust (EPT):

EPT was established in 2012 as a multi-academy trust and is an approved academy sponsor. Our vision is to create outstanding schools which transform learning, lives and communities. We benefit from our diverse and unique range of schools which include secondary mainstream, alternative provision and special and have a proven track record of sustained improvement. Our schools are united by a drive to improve opportunities and outcomes for children and young people within a collaborative learning culture.
